1984 Austin Maestro vs. 1991 Mitsubishi Sigma

To start off, 1991 Mitsubishi Sigma is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Austin Maestro.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Austin Maestro would be higher. At 2,972 cc (6 cylinders), 1991 Mitsubishi Sigma is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1991 Mitsubishi Sigma (202 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 136 more horse power than 1984 Austin Maestro. (66 HP @ 5600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1991 Mitsubishi Sigma should accelerate faster than 1984 Austin Maestro.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1991 Mitsubishi Sigma weights approximately 665 kg more than 1984 Austin Maestro.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1991 Mitsubishi Sigma (270 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 168 more torque (in Nm) than 1984 Austin Maestro. (102 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 1991 Mitsubishi Sigma will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1984 Austin Maestro.
